| description | Abstract This paper is designed for heavy pulsars coming from the Neutron Star Interior Composition Explorer. The research model is describe by Einstein field equations for anisotropic fluid configuration with spherical symmetry. As per present perceptiveness, modified non-linear Van der Waals equation of state is used to relate physical variables. The continuity of inner and outer matter is obtained by comparing inner spacetime to outer Schwarzschild metric. The physical viability of this model is evaluated and further it is compared with observational data of pulsars PSR J0348+0432, PSR J0740+6620 and PSR J0030+0451. The model fulfils all physical and mathematical characteristics of the dense structure studies. It offers the factual proofs carried by evolution of celestial configurations. The working model presented here is physically viable and shows stable behaviour. |
